We estimate that about 182 million people will work in OASDI-covered employment in 2024. We estimate that about 94 percent of workers in paid employment and self-employment are covered under the OASDI program. Benefit receipt among the elderly. To qualify for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) benefits, you must: Have worked in jobs covered by Social Security. Have a medical condition that meets Social Security's strict definition of disability. In general, we pay monthly benefits to people who are unable to work for a year or more because of a disability.

Quoted: USAA is a mutual insurance company. It is owned by the policy holders. Like any corporation, if the company has a profitable year, it returns a portion of teh profits to the owners. In 2024, the Social Security payroll tax is 12.4 percent, but you only pay 6.2 percent of your wages. The company that employs you pays the other half. The income level at which that tax stops is $168,600. Self-employed individuals must pay the entire 12.4 percent.

Much better!Jun 3, 2019 · The subscriber savings account is considered a return of premium, insurance premium, and not taxable. USAA subscriber savings account distributions are not taxable income for federal or state income tax purposes. You will not have to report that on the 2023 Form 1040. You can use your account to request a replacement Social Security card, check the status of an application, estimate future benefits, or manage the benefits you already …The 3.2 percent cost-of-living adjustment (COLA) will begin with benefits payable to more than 66 million Social Security beneficiaries in January 2024. Increased payments to approximately 7.5 million SSI recipients will begin on December 29, 2023. Supplemental Security Income (SSI), or both, October 2023 (in thousands) Type of beneficiary Total Social Security only SSI only Both Social Security and SSI; All beneficiaries: 71,483: 64,019: 4,948: 2,516 ... jeep compass shuts off while driving Apr 2, 2024 · The rules for required minimum distributions, or RMDs, have changed over the years and, once again, with the newer Secure 2.0 Act of 2022. For many years, the RMD age was 70½ for those reaching age 70½ before 2019. Then the Secure Act of 2019 changed the RMD age to 72 for those reaching 70½ in 2020 or later.
